Normalización Sql

Páginas: 3 (571 palabras) Publicado: 29 de agosto de 2011
ACTIVIDAD No.1 |
La empresa COLOMBIAN SYSTEMS lo ha contratado como el “Ingeniero Encargado” para sistematizar la facturación. En la siguiente FACTURA DE COMPRA VENTA, usted debe analizar toda lainformación disponible y debe crear el DICCIONARIO DE DATOS.Una vez tenga el Diccionario de Datos, haga un análisis ARD y ejecute el proceso de normalización, hasta llegar a la Tercera Forma Normal.Laidea es realizar la respectiva justificación detallada de cada uno de los pasos que conduzcan al resultado final. . |
Ejercite SQL es la única forma de aprender. |

NORMALIZACIÓN

FORMA UNF(NO NORMALIZADA)
Diccionario de datos.
En esta primer paso se obtiene un listado de los datos que se encuentran la en la Factura de Compra-Venta. Donde se identifica una llave que en este caso esFAC-NO.

FAC-NO: número Factura de Compra-venta.FAC-FECHA: fecha número de Factura de Compra-Venta.CLI-NOMBRE: nombre del cliente.CLI-DIRECIÓN: dirección del cliente.CLI-CÉDULA/NIT: cédula o NITdel cliente.CLI-CIUDAD: ciudad origen cliente.CLI-TELÉFONO: teléfono del cliente.CATEGORÍA: categoría del producto.CÓDIGO: código del producto.DESCRIPCIÓN: nombre del producto.VR.UNIT: valor unitariodel producto.CANTIDAD: cantidad a pedir del producto. |

PRIMERA FORMA NORMAL (1FN)
Separar el grupo repetitivo.
En la factura hay datos repetitivos es decir que para una factura aparecen variasveces como por ejemplo DESCRIPCIÓN. Estos datos deben ser separados y con su respectiva llave.

GRUPO NO REPETITIVOFAC-NOFAC-FECHACLI-NOMBRECLI-DIRECIÓNCLI-CÉDULA/NITCLI-CIUDADCLI-TELÉFONO | GRUPOREPETITIVOCATEGORÍACÓDIGODESCRIPCIÓNVR.UNITCANTIDAD |

El grupo repetitivo tiene a CÓDIGO llave. Sin embargo, esta llave no es única, dado que se puede repetir en otras facturas de compra-venta.Necesita ser combinada con la llave del primer grupo. Al combinar el campo FAC-NO junto con el campo CÓDIGO para el segundo grupo, podemos deducir que esta combinación puede actuar como llave única,...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Normalizacion-sql
  • Normalizacion sql dicc
  • Tema:  Introducción A Sql
  • normalizacion
  • LA NORMALIZACION
  • Normalizacion
  • normalizacion
  • la normalizacion

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S